Testing Time I think that middle schoolers should get to read for an hour a day at school. This way students will be reading more often. reading is an important part of life. If someone was reading a book and it took them a month, they would appear very illiterate. Read ing is an everyday activity as well as a source of entertainment. Instead of playing video games students could read a book. I am so sad to see my peers who treat reading like a punishment instead of a privilege. There was a time when only very rich and very important people were treated to the art of reading and writing. We are lucky to be in a time were such creative and brilliant minds live. This is why I think that we should get to read for an hour a day at school.
